Understanding 338 Investment Fiduciary Services

A 338 fiduciary is responsible for managing all aspects of a retirement plan’s investments, including selection, monitoring, and rebalancing of assets. Unlike other fiduciary roles, a 338 fiduciary has full discretionary authority, relieving employers of significant investment-related responsibilities and liabilities.

Key Risks in Retirement Plan Investments

Before diving into mitigation strategies, it’s essential to recognize common risks that can impact retirement plans:

  • Market Volatility: Economic fluctuations can negatively affect investment returns, leading to participant losses.
  • Regulatory Compliance Risks: Failure to comply with ERISA and DOL regulations can result in penalties and legal challenges.
  • Exposure to High-Risk Investments: Without diligent oversight, plans may inadvertently include volatile or speculative assets.

Proven Risk Mitigation Strategies Used by 338 Fiduciaries

1. Strategic Portfolio Diversification

Diversification is one of the most effective methods to mitigate investment risk. By spreading assets across various asset classes, fiduciaries reduce the impact of market downturns on overall portfolio performance.

Example: A well-balanced portfolio may include equities, bonds, real estate, and alternative investments to ensure risk-adjusted returns.

Benefit: Minimizes exposure to individual asset fluctuations and enhances long-term stability.

2. Ongoing Performance Monitoring & Adjustments

Continuous monitoring of investments allows fiduciaries to identify underperforming assets and make timely adjustments.

Tools Used: Advanced analytics, performance benchmarks, and investment trend analysis guide decision-making.

Outcome: Improved plan stability, optimized returns, and increased participant confidence.

3. Adherence to a Robust Investment Policy Statement (IPS)

An Investment Policy Statement (IPS) serves as a blueprint for investment decisions, outlining objectives, risk tolerance, and selection criteria.

Strategy: 338 fiduciaries ensure all investments align with the IPS, maintaining consistency and reducing unnecessary risks.

Impact: Provides a structured framework that prevents exposure to speculative or misaligned investments.

4. Strict Regulatory Compliance & Risk Assessments

Staying ahead of evolving ERISA, IRS, and DOL regulations is critical to maintaining compliance and protecting employers from liability.

Process: Regular audits, compliance reviews, and risk assessments help identify and mitigate potential issues before they become liabilities.

Advantage: Reduces the likelihood of regulatory penalties and legal repercussions.
